What is the CLIA Application for Certification?
The CLIA Application for Certification is a vital document for clinical laboratory certification in the United States. This application is a key part of the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ments (CLIA) program, which sets the standards for laboratory testing to ensure accuracy and reliability.
The form is essential for laboratories that wish to obtain clinical lab certification, demonstrating their compliance with federal regulations and improving their operational credibility. The application gathers critical details about the lab, including its ownership and the types of tests performed.
Purpose and Benefits of the CLIA Application for Certification
The primary purpose of the CLIA application form is to establish a framework for medical lab registration that ensures laboratories meet the necessary quality standards. Obtaining this certification carries several substantial benefits.
-
Enhances laboratory credibility and trust among patients and healthcare providers.
-
Ensures compliance with federal regulations, reducing the risk of penalties.
-
Improves patient care through adherence to high-quality testing standards.
Who Needs the CLIA Application for Certification?
The CLIA application is crucial for various stakeholders, primarily laboratory owners and directors who are responsible for operating testing facilities. Certification is required for laboratories that perform specific tests on human specimens, covering a range of facilities from small clinics to large hospitals.
Those involved in clinical testing activities must ensure they complete this certification process to maintain compliance and uphold the integrity of laboratory results.

Who is eligible to complete the CLIA Application for Certification?
Eligibility to complete the CLIA Application for Certification generally includes owners and directors of clinical laboratories that test human specimens for diagnostic purposes. It is essential for the individual to ensure that the laboratory complies with CLIA regulations.
What documents are required when submitting the CLIA Application?
When submitting the CLIA Application for Certification, typically, you will need to provide detailed laboratory information, ownership documentation, and any other supporting materials as indicated in the application instructions. Always check specific guidelines for your state.
Are there deadlines for submitting the CLIA Application?
Deadlines for submitting the CLIA Application for Certification can vary. It is advisable to submit your application at least a few months before any planned tests to ensure timely processing and avoid potential delays in certification.
How do I submit the completed CLIA Application for Certification?
The completed CLIA Application can be submitted through pdfFiller if you choose the digital submission option, or you may need to send it to your local State Agency via mail, depending on local regulations.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the application?
Common mistakes in the CLIA Application include incomplete information, incorrect facility details, failing to sign the application, or not providing required supporting documents. Always double-check your entries before final submission.
How long does it take to process the CLIA Application after submission?
Processing times for the CLIA Application for Certification can vary depending on the state and local agency. Generally, it may take several weeks, so it's advisable to apply well in advance of when certification is needed.
